The 2010/2011 SCD Graduation and Awards ceremony took place in O'Reilly Hall UCD on Friday 25 November 2011. The Leader of the Labour Party, Tánaiste & Minister for Foreign Affairs and Trade, Eamon Gilmore, TD was the guest of honour at this special event.
This celebratory occasion acknowledged individual and group achievements, paid tribute to the excellent work of the College and its staff and honoured the recipients of awards.
The event was attended by the CEO of Dun Laoghaire VEC, Carol Hanney, members of SCD's Board of Management, former CEO of Dun Laoghaire VEC, John Ryan and former Principals of SCD, Jack Griffin and Barry O'Callaghan as well as representatives from various professional awarding bodies.
The SCD Honorary Graduate Award was presented to John Lonergan in recognition of his contribution as former Governor of Mountjoy Prison. Stefan Paz Berrios, former SCD graduate, was the recipient of the Patrick O'Reilly Graduate Award. Stefan currently lectures in Multimedia in the Institute of Art, Design and Technology, Dun Laoghaire and Senior College Dun Laoghaire.
